I'm new to this whole "switch hacking" so have a simple question. I just opened a second current account with Nationwide to use as a donor to switch to NatWest. The new account has appeared in my Nationwide app so can I now go ahead with switching to NatWest, or do I need to wait for the debit card to arrive and maybe activate it?

You can try, but Nationwide will likely decline the switch if you have a debit card assigned to the account (regardless of whether said card is yet in your possession/usable).No need to activate tho, you just need the PAN (card number). Just wait a few days for it to arrive, Natwest offers normally last months so no need to rush.1

NatWest will ask if the account you are switching from has a card associated with it. It gives 3 options. 1. Yes 2. No I don’t have a card associated with this account 3. My card is lost or stolen
I clicked option 2 and a button came up saying ‘check the account is eligible’ - mine was because it is a chase account that doesn’t have a card associated with it.I think if you are switching from an account with an active card it might be best to wait until it arrives just to be safe.Save £12k in 2024: £13,542/£12,0001
